Bless you so hard.Aaronh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/14960968845571968908no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8225561719615755856.post-38343450578156254012011-06-16T18:06:00.219-05:002011-06-16T18:06:00.219-05:00Sexy Zombie romance literature may not have gotten...Sexy Zombie romance literature may not have gotten particularly popular (because, ew) but there are a few teen-oriented books out there about living girls crushing on living-dead guys. "I Kissed a Zombie, and I Liked It" by Adam Selzer and "Generation Dead" by Daniel Waters seem to fit the mold. There's also "Hungry for Your Love: An Anthology of Zombie Romance" which came out last year. <br /><br />I haven't read them (again, ew) but they do check out of the library.<br /><br />So just because there aren't a lot of sexy zombie movies out there right now doesn't mean they didn't try to make it happen.Dannyh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/17446276585953704608noreply@blogger.com
